Overview

Published in English for the first time, this groundbreaking book by Radomir Ristic is a compilation of historical data, anthropological studies, and the authors own experiences and interviews with the Witches of the Balkans. Covering both theory and practice, the book gives a complete system of Balkan Traditional Witchcraft.

Balkan Traditional Witchcraft is an ancient system from humanity's dawn that has survived into modern times due to the unique history of the region, and its practice can be applied to any culture, state or region in the world.

Translated into English by Michael C. Carter, Jr., this book – a bestseller in its native Serbia – is an incredible look into the world of the Balkan Witch, covering ritual trance, tools, rites for healing, love, divination, defense and for making charms. It also explores the supernatural beings that Balkan Witches share their world with, deities, fairies and other spirits. There has never been such a deep exploration of the magic of this region available in English before.

About the Author

Radomir Ristic is a published author from southeast Europe. He is proficient in southeast European traditions as well as some Middle East, African and south-American ones.

He was born in Serbia, where he graduated in the authorised training centre for Autodesk, Centre Group; as a programmer of applicative animation. After getting in touch with old Balkan traditions like Witchcraft, folk paganism, shamanism and folk medicine, he decided to continue his education by studying ethnology and anthropology.

Radomir also attends all kind of courses in mythology, folklore and psychoanalysis, gooing to lectures and field trips all over the Balkans. He does interviews with Cunningfolk, Witches, Shamans, Healers, Herbalists and folk Clairvoyants, in order to find out about their traditions and their world view today, in the rural regions of the Balkans.

During his travels he has been introduced to two different Serbian traditions and one Vlachian, but he writes about many others also. He often shares his field discoveries with scientists. Based on the data available from literature, field discoveries, personal experiences and consultations and interviews with historians, anthropologists, occultists and mystics, he writes his books some of which are: "Balkan traditional witchcraft", "Mystery of Witchcraft", and "The Last European Shamans". Besides writing books, Radomir also publishes his articles in "The Crooked Path Journal" and "The Cauldron" magazine.
